An FTIR spectrometer is a device which uses infrared radiation from 400 to 4000 cm-1 to obtain vibration spectra of the compounds tested. The obtained FTIR spectra make it possible to determine the molecular structure of the analysed compound on the basis of identification of individual function groups. The FTIR spectrometer is used mainly for testing organic compounds. It offers the possibility of testing solids, liquids and gas samples (transmission adapter) and direct testing of thin layers on substrates (ATR adapter).
